  • The purposes of this study were 1) to examine the dimension of fashion shopping mall attributes and shopping value related to online shopping, and 2) to investigate the effects of fashion shopping mall attributes and shopping value on purchase intention in online shopping. Data were obtained from 423 online fashion shopping mall consumers who have experiences of buying products or visiting to online fashion shopping mall in Busan, and were analyzed using by factor analysis, Cronbach's alpha, path analysis of LISREL 8.53. The results showed online fashion shopping mall attributes were composed of Visual information, Loading speed Space composition, Product assortment, Checkout service, and Help desk. Shopping value perceived by online fashion shopping mall consumers were consisted two factors: Hedonic value and Utility value. Hedonic value and Utility value Perceive by online consumers were influenced by Product assortment, Visual information, Help desk, and Space composition of shopping mall. Additionally, hedonic and utility shopping values perceive by online consumers impacted online purchase intention. Findings suggest that fashion shopping mall attributes mediated by shopping values are important in predicting purchase intention of online shopping mall. Implications are drawn for the information useful to consumer behavior researchers and retailers of online fashion shopping mall.

  • The purposes of this study were to investigate the effects of shopping orientation on fashion shopping mall environments and purchase intention in internet fashion shopping mall. Data were obtained from 423 internet fashion shopping mall consumers who have experiences of buying products or visiting to internet fashion shopping mall in Busan, and were analyzed using by factor analysis, Cronbach's alpha, cluster analysis, ANOVA and Duncan test. The results showed shopping orientation perceived by Internet fashion shopping mall consumers were consisted five factors: Brand loyalty orientation, Economical orientation, Fashion orientation, Time saving orientation and Internet shopping orientation. Internet fashion shopping mall environments were composed of Visual information, Loading speed, Space composition, Product assortment, Checkout service, and Help desk. Consumers were classified by the shopping orientation into the Economical shopper, Fashion/brand shopper, and Convenience shopper. Economical shopper and Fashion/brand shopper rise in the estimation of Visual information, Product assortment, and Checkout service of shopping mall environment. Additionally, they were likely to have more intentions to purchase than the other types of shoppers in internet fashion shopping mall.

  • The purposes of this study were 1) to examine the conceptual structure of shopping value, fashion shopping mall attributes and emotions related to internet shopping, 2) to compare between hedonic consumers and utility consumers of fashion shopping mall attributes, emotions and purchasing intention and 3) to investigate the effects of shopping value, fashion shopping mall attributes, emotions and purchasing intention on purchasing behavior in internet fashion shopping malls. Data were obtained from 423 internet fashion shopping mall consumers who have bought products or visited an internet fashion shopping mall. The data were analyzed by using factor analysis, Cronbach's alpha, t-test and discriminant analysis. The results showed that shopping values perceived by internet fashion shopping mall consumers consisted of two factors: Hedonic value and Utility value. Internet fashion shopping mall attributes were composed of Visual information, Loading speed, Space composition, Product assortment, Checkout service and Help desk. Emotions were composed of Excitement Confidence, Displeasure and Uneasiness. There results demonstrated that hedonic consumers were more likely to perceive the factors of fashion shopping mail attributes, to experience various, emotions and to have more purchasing intention than utility consumers. Additionally, the findings suggest that shopping value is important in predicting the purchasing behavior of consumers' at internet fashion shopping malls. They gave insights into the promotion development of internet fashion shopping malls. Implications are drawn for the information useful to consumer behavior researchers and retailers of internet fashion shopping malls.

  • This article is about the naming method for fashion product in cyber shopping mall. For two months, the name of fashion product is listed and analyzed, from BEST 100 category in cyber shopping mall. SPSS ver.10.0 is used and frequency, spearman raw test and t-test are done. The fashion product names are arranged in naming method. There are four kinds of methods for fashion product naming; describing, associating, bundling and style numbering. Describing is most used method both cyber shopping mall. Between marketplace cyber shopping mall and merchant, there is significant difference in composition of naming. Bundling naming method is more used in marketplace cyber shopping mall, and describing and style numbering method is used often in merchant. The words which are composed the name of fashion product are divided in a single word and arranged. The words for describing are classified in noun and adjective. Noun is used for depicting textile and construction and adjective is for touch and image. There is no difference for using words between marketplace and merchant.

  • Shopping malls have become key players in the Indian retail space. Even in upcoming Indian towns, malls have been mushrooming. Raipur, the capital city of the Indian state of Chhattisgarh has witnessed the growth over the last few years. However, this unplanned growth of malls in cities is expected to lead to oversupply of mall space in the near future, making things difficult for mall developers. The study is an attempt to identify appropriate strategies for mall developers to iron out such kinks. This paper presents 'shopping experience' as a tool to compete, succeed and explore its composition in terms of its constituent factors. The paper uses Exploratory Factor Analysis (EFA) on a non-probability sample of 350 respondents. It condenses a set of twenty-two mall variables into five factors that directly influence the shopping experience. These factors included ambience, infrastructure, marketing focus, convenience and safety and security. In terms of significance, shoppers assigned different weightage to each of these factors. The study shed light on interesting insights regarding the expectations of mall shoppers in the city of Raipur. The results though interesting, may be extended to different social, economic and geographic contexts to check the universality. While strategizing, mall developers must assign proportionate effort on the factors based on the respective contribution to shopping experience. In light of intensifying competition in Raipur, the study is significant for future prospects of malls. In the absence of a scientific and objective basis, the developers run risk of making wrong investment and management decisions. This paper is a useful addition to the body of knowledge on management of shopping malls in India and is unique in terms of its focus on mall shoppers in the smaller Indian cities like Raipur.

  • Internet shopping mall has become a huge distribution channel with dramatic growth in recent years. The number of consumers has exponentially increased as the scale of shopping mall has been large so that shopping malls with thousands or millions of consumers become a general case. However, it is essential to evaluate whether current assortment of consumers is proper or not in the strategic aspect in order to operate Internet shopping mall effectively and gain profits. That is, it is important to evaluate whether consumer strategy of corporation is proper or not from the corporation. Despite this business importance, consumer assortment has not been evaluated well and related study is not sufficient. This study supposes a framework for consumer assortment evaluation, which evaluates whether consumer assortment of Internet shopping mall is proper or not. In the framework for consumer assortment evaluation, analysis data based on order data and consumer data in database is made. Then, four factors, consumer maintenance rate, consumer profitability, consumer securing rate and consumer conversion are setup, and 22 measurement indexes are drawn. Finally, a consumer assortment evaluation score card is made by integrating them. This study has applied a supposed framework to a domestic typical community based shopping mall, and it is expected that the evaluation result will be used as informant strategic information to operate the shopping mall effectively.
